Perched on the 118ᵗʰ floor of the International Commerce Centre, Ozone crowns The Ritz-Carlton, Hong Kong at a vertigo-inducing 490 m above sea level, making it one of the highest rooftop bars on the planet. Step out of the lift and you’re immersed in a sci-fi dreamscape: honey-comb vaulted ceilings, lacquer-black terrazzo floors and pulsating sapphire lightscapes conceived by Japanese design studio Wonderwall. A wrap-around outdoor terrace frames an uninterrupted panorama of Victoria Harbour and the island skyline—spectacular at sunset and positively electric after dark. The beverage programme leans heavily into modern mixology: signature cocktails (≈ HK $208 / US $25) showcase Asian botanicals, house-infused spirits and premium Champagne, while an extensive list of whiskies, rare tequilas and large-format bottles keeps celebratory nights humming. Asian-inspired tapas, sushi and decadent weekend brunches pair seamlessly with the drinks menu. Evenings segue from laid-back lounge to high-energy nightlife when international guest DJs spin house, R&B and techno sets, helped by a state-of-the-art sound system. Dress codes are smart-casual by day and upscale chic by night, and reservations are strongly recommended.
